The Step-by-Step Manufacturing Process of Bagasse Tableware
Bagasse tableware factory is an eco-friendly alternative to traditional plastic and foam products, made from the fibrous residue left over after sugarcane juice extraction. It is biodegradable, compostable, and a popular choice for sustainable food packaging. The process of manufacturing bagasse tableware involves several stages, from raw material preparation to the final product. Here's an overview of how bagasse tableware is made.
Collection and Processing of Bagasse
The first step in manufacturing bagasse tableware is collecting the bagasse, which is the leftover fiber from sugarcane after the juice has been extracted. Once harvested, the bagasse is cleaned and processed to remove impurities such as dirt or small particles. The fiber is then dried to a suitable moisture level before it is ready to be converted into tableware.
Pulping and Molding
Once the bagasse is processed, it is mixed with water to create a pulp. The pulp is then poured into molds that form the desired shape of the tableware, such as plates, bowls, or trays. High pressure is applied to the mold to ensure the pulp takes the shape correctly and becomes compact. In some cases, natural binders or additives may be added to improve the structural integrity of the final product.
Drying and Quality Control
After the molding process, the bagasse tableware is dried using either heat or air drying methods to remove excess moisture. This ensures the products retain their strength and durability. Once dried, the tableware undergoes quality control checks to ensure it meets the required standards for appearance and functionality. Finally, the tableware is packaged and ready for distribution.
